Estudiantes draw 3-3 with Lanus PDF Print E-mail
Friday, 04 April 2008

ImageBUENOS AIRES (AP) - Goalkeeper Mariano Andujar blocked a penalty and the ensuing shot off the rebound in extra time to preserve a 3-3 draw for Estudiantes against Lanus on Wednesday, keeping it atop Group 2 in the Copa Libertadores.

Estudiantes rallied from a two-goal deficit to lead 3-2 but allowed a 78th-minute equalizer by Lautaro Acosta that cost it a chance to clinch a berth in the second round.

Acosta, looking for the winner in extra time, raced into the penalty area and appeared to fall as he round Andujar. Referee Pablo Lunati called a foul and Jose Sand stepped up to take the penalty in the first minute of extra time.

With Lanus fans thundering in the stands, Andujar dived to his left to block Sand's low, right-footed attempt, and then scrambled to recover in time to deflect Sand's follow-up effort over the bar with his hip.

"It was a fast-changing match, but we were able to pick up the point we needed, which was the important thing," Andujar said.

The result beforea crowd of 25,000 at Buenos Aires' Lanus stadium gave Estudiantes eight points, one ahead of Lanus and two ahead of Deportivo Cuenca of Ecuador. Danubio of Uruguay is last with four points. One one match remains for each, and only two will advance.

Danubio next receives Lanus at home in Uruguay on April 15, while Estudiantes will play host to Deportivo Cuenca the same night.



Estudiantes earned the draw despite playing much of the second half one man down after the expulsion of Agustin Alayes for rough play. Both finished with 10 men when Santiago Hoyos was sent off in the 85th for the same infraction.

The match opened with Lanus taking a 1-0 lead off a left-footer by Sand in the 10th minute, followed by a second goal five minutes later by teammate Diego Valeri, who pounched on a loose ball in the area.

Estudiantes equalifed on a header by Leandro Desabato in the 21st and a free kick by Leandro Benitez three minutes later, his ball sharply angling inside the post past Lanus goalkeeper Carlos Bossio.

Estudiantes went ahead 3-2 in the 62nd minute with a goal by Ivan Moreno y Fabianese, a ground-searing left-footer. Acosta equalized with a powerful left-footer inside the area.
